== Disease ==
 +
[https://www.uniprot.org/uniprot/SPN90_HUMAN SPN90_HUMAN] A chromosomal aberration involving NCKIPSD/AF3p21 is found in therapy-related leukemia. Translocation t(3;11)(p21;q23) with KMT2A/MLL1.<ref>PMID:10648423</ref>

== Function ==
 +
[https://www.uniprot.org/uniprot/SPN90_HUMAN SPN90_HUMAN] Has an important role in stress fiber formation induced by active diaphanous protein homolog 1 (DRF1). Induces microspike formation, in vivo (By similarity). In vitro, stimulates N-WASP-induced ARP2/3 complex activation in the absence of CDC42 (By similarity). May play an important role in the maintenance of sarcomeres and/or in the assembly of myofibrils into sarcomeres. Implicated in regulation of actin polymerization and cell adhesion. Plays a role in angiogenesis.<ref>PMID:22419821</ref>
